We are experiencing an intermittent but reproducible problem, where 
establishing a new connection to Apache httpd sometimes takes up to 30 seconds. 
We are running 350 threads with +-20 threads in keepalive state (according to 
/server-stats) and nothing else connecting or executing in Apache at the time 
the new connection comes in. There _should_ be a thread available for a new 
connection and the socket accept _should_ be listening. What we are seeing is 
that there is a pause between when the network card receives the message and 
Apache gets the message. In the test we were using a Java HttpConnection but we 
can reproduce the problem with IE and Firefox as well. There is no firewall on 
the machine.

Can anybody please explain why this could be happening or how we can go about 
finding the delay.

-TRACE------------------------
A case in point (delay of 17 seconds), running Packetyzer 5.0.0 on the network 
card:
 
13:02:25.249190000 client -> server : SYN (62 bytes)
13:02:25.249224000 server -> client : SYN ACK (62 bytes)
13:02:25.251134000 client -> server : ACK (60 bytes)
13:02:25.251864000 client -> server : HTTP GET (268 bytes)
13:02:25.442069000 server -> client : ACK (54 bytes)
13:02:42.960316000 server -> client : HTTP DATA (1514 bytes)
13:02:42.960327000 server -> client : HTTP continuation (155 bytes)
13:02:42.963080000 client -> server : ACK (60 bytes)
 
and then access.log (using LogFormat "%h %l %u %t \"%r\" %>s %b (%T/%D) 
\"%{Referer}i\" \"%{User-Agent}i\"" combined) indicates an execution time of 
31,250 milliseconds.

[client-ip] - - [12/May/2008:13:02:42 +0200] "GET /xxxxx/xxxx HTTP/1.1" 200 
1310 (0/31250) "-" "Java(tm) 2 SDK, Standard Edition v1.5.0_10 Java/1.5.0_10"
